Default Warm fluid feel with csf Leak?

Hi, I have had a warm fluid leak feeling in my ear and occasionally right side of neck for about 8 months. I went to the ENT because I also have had echoing 4 times. I had an MRI with contrast, hearing tests, 3 specialized hearing tests and today a Cat Scan. The MRI shows a lipoma, which apparantly is a fatty tumor the size of a pea on my brain stem. Going to the Neurologist for that in 2 weeks. But, all the specialist so far said to not worry.
My Question: Does a CSf leak feel warm? They all say I should not feel the leak in my ear, as you don't have sensation there.... 2 Times, I had severe sinus headache, and then my sinuses drained quickly. I felt the warm liquid go in my ear. One of the times, I could taste watery salty liquid in the back of my throat all day, and the warm liquid in my ear all day.
My doctor gave me a speciman cup to try to catch that liquid coming out of my nose to see if it is cerebral fluid.
I only get sinus headaches, and when the fluid is leaking in my ear, I have no sinus pressure. So, Is the fluid really warm. I really am feeling it, even though they say I should not be able to.... Thank you for any help.
